#1Hate Plus
Hate Plus
CasualVisual Novel
SoloNarrativeSci-FiFantasyAnime
Steam👍 84%· 587RAWG👍 75%· 20IGDB80· 1
Year 2013Dev Love Conquers All GamesPlaytime ~3hOn PC · Apple Macintosh · Linux

✓ If you enjoyed Taimanin Yukikaze, expect visual novel storytelling, adventure storytelling and strong narrative focus

≠ Where it differs: brings historical setting, while skipping cozy, relaxing feel

Let's spend the next three real-time days together uncovering the mystery of what went horribly wrong on a derelict generation ship, with the help of a spunky/more-than-slightly-traumatized AI sidekick! A sequel to Analogue: A Hate Story that tells a whole new hate story of its own.

VA-11 Hall-A: Cyberpunk Bartender Action
CasualVisual Novel
SoloNarrativeCozySci-FiAnime2D
Steam👍 97%· 38KRAWG👍 89%· 441MC81IGDB84· 9OC84· 66
Year 2016Dev Wolfgame · Ysbryd GamesPlaytime ~5hOn PC · PS · Apple Macintosh

✓ If you enjoyed Taimanin Yukikaze, expect visual novel storytelling, adventure storytelling and strong narrative focus

≠ Stands apart with deep simulation, puzzle design and vibe casual, while skipping dark, oppressive atmosphere

VA-11 HALL-A: Cyberpunk Bartender Action is a booze em' up about waifus, technology, and post-dystopia life. In this world, corporations reign supreme, all human life is infected with nanomachines designed to oppress them, and the terrifying White Knights ensure that everyone obeys the laws. But, this is not about those people.

#3eden*
eden*
CasualVisual Novel
SoloNarrativeCozyAnimeSci-Fi
Steam👍 97%· 5.1K
Year 2015Dev Key · MangaGamerPlaytime ~4hOn PC

✓ Nearly identical: visual novel storytelling, adventure storytelling and strong narrative focus.

≠ Missing: dark, oppressive atmosphere.

The final love story on a dying planet. In the near future, an ominous red star suddenly appears in the sky. Its presence is about to bring about the extinction of all life on Earth. The unified government proposes an evacuation project to take all of mankind into space, but in order to make the seemingly impossible project a reality, 'felixes' are brought into the world.

planetarian HD
CasualVisual Novel
SoloNarrativeCozyAnimeSci-Fi
Steam👍 99%· 3.3K
Year 2017Dev VisualArts/Key · VisualArtsPlaytime ~3hOn PC

✓ If you enjoyed Taimanin Yukikaze, expect visual novel storytelling, adventure storytelling and strong narrative focus

≠ Where it differs: brings deep simulation, vibe casual and post-apocalyptic world, while skipping dark, oppressive atmosphere

It is thirty years after the failure of the Space Colonization Program. Humanity is nearly extinct. A perpetual and deadly Rain falls on the Earth. Men known as "Junkers" plunder goods and artifacts from the ruins of civilization. One such Junker sneaks alone into the most dangerous of all ruins -- a "Sarcophagus City". In the center of this dead city, he discovers a pre-War planetarium.
